//java代码//String 是引用类型,可以直接拼接public static void main(String[] args) {//String类型值改变,会新创建一个对象,抛弃原有数据不会再用 建议字符...
而在C中,两个用""包含的字符串,在没有任何可见字符(不包括空格,换行,tab)分隔,写在一起的时候 会当做一个字符串处理 也就是 "abc" "def"和 "abcdef"是等效的...
这个直接写就可以的 define NEW DEV_CHANNEL"/2"这个宏就是 /dev/xxxx/2
符号把一个符号直接转换为字符串,例如:define STRING(x) #x const char *str = STRING( test_string ); str的内容就是"test_string",也就是说#会把其后的符号 ...
(一)宏定义中的 连接符与 符 连接符号由两个井号组成,其功能是在带参数的宏定义中将两个子串(token)联接起来,从而形成一个新的子串。但它不可以是第一个或者最后...
define 宏只能定义常量,#define 宏本质就是字符串替换,无法满足您说的定义一个宏变量,例如:#define STR "ABCD"意思是:在这个宏范围内,将STR替换为“ABCD”的...
宏定义字符串拼接可以使用宏运算##,即 #define strcat(x,y) x##y。 ##运算符可以将两个记号(例如标识符)“粘”在一起,成为一个记号。如果其中一个操作数是宏参...
在C语言中,可以使用预处理器的宏和连接运算符##来拼接变量的数值。以下是您提供的示例代码进行修改:在上述代码中...
1、第一步,打开excel软件,见下图,转到下面的步骤。2、第二步,完成上述步骤后,打开VBA编程界面,见下图,转到下...
C语言 宏定义字符串问题 有这样一个字符串:“AAAAAAAxxxBBBBBBBBBB”,其中AAAAAAA和BBBBBBBBBB都是固定字符串,而xxx是可变的。我想定义一个带参数的宏,参数就...
其他小伙伴的相似问题3 | ||
---|---|---|
宏程序编程教学 | c语言宏定义的例子 | 宏程序编程一百例 |
字符串拼接的几种方式 | java两个字符串拼接 | c语言宏定义用法规则 |
python拼接字符串 | string字符串怎么拼接 | java宏定义 |
标准库string判断相等 | 返回首页 |
返回顶部 |